Question

If nPr = 720 and nCr = 120, then the value of r is:

The correct answer is

3

Calculation:

\(720 = \;\frac{{n!}}{{\left( {n\; - \;r} \right)!}}\)

\((n-r)! = \frac{n!}{720}\)

\(120 = \frac{{n!}}{{r!\left( {n\; - \;r} \right)!}}\)

Putting the value of (n - r)! we get

\(120 = \frac{n!}{r! \frac{n!}{720}}\)

r! = 720/120 = 6  (= 3 × 2 × 1)

r = 3
